Stuffed Squid

BNHmMtXl.jpg


Ingredients:

  • 4 large squid
  • 1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 finely cut red dried onion
  • 2 spring onions, finely cut
  • 1/2 cup Arborio Rice (substitute for the original rice)
  • 2 tablespoons Zante currants
  • 1/3 cup dry white wine
  • 2 tablespoons finely chopped dill
  • 1 cup grated tomatoes
  • Olive oil, salt, ground pepper
Instructions:

  1. Chop the squid tentacles finely. In a pan, warm the olive oil, then add the dried onion and spring onions. Stir for a minute and add the chopped tentacles. Stir for about 5 minutes.
  2. Add Arborio rice, currants, and white wine. Wait 2 minutes until the alcohol evaporates. Add 1 1/2 cups of water, season with salt and pepper, and sprinkle with chopped dill.
  3. Wait until the liquids reduce by half.
  4. Spoon the cooled rice mix into the squid tubes, securing the open end with cocktail sticks. Arrange the stuffed squids in a small ovenproof pan.
  5. Drizzle olive oil and grated tomatoes over the squid.
  6. Bake at 180°C for 15 minutes covered, then another 15 minutes uncovered.
